This document surveys open-source health information systems, emphasizing their role in transitioning the US medical industry to electronic health records as mandated by the HITECH Act. It discusses the functionality, implementation technologies, and security features of various systems, including electronic medical records and personal health records, highlighting their benefits such as improved patient care and reduced medical errors. The analysis also examines specific open-source systems like ClearHealth, CAISIS, OpenMRS, and OpenEMR, detailing their development, features, and compliance with HIPAA security standards.
